                I just tried this extension. Thanks. Do you know why some headers are listed twice in my headers list? even Thought They Are Once In The HTACCESS File?

                Reply Quote 0
                  alexandgus 1 Reply Last reply
                • alexandgus
                  alexandgus @ajtruckle last edited by

                  @ajtruckle

                  If a header appears twice, it is defined at least twice.
                  Apache can define headers.
                  The config can contain header definitions.
                  Then, and only at the end, a .htaccess can also define a header.
